Lithium Fluoride and Energy Storage Lithium fluoride (LiF) is a compound that has gained significant attention in the field of energy storage due to its exceptional thermal stability and high heat capacity. These properties make lithium fluoride an ideal material for molten salt energy storage systems, which are widely used in concentrated solar power (CSP) plants. In CSP systems, solar energy is harnessed and stored in the form of heat in molten salt solutions. The stored thermal energy can then be converted into electricity when needed. Lithium fluoride is commonly used as one of the salt components due to its ability to enhance the heat transfer efficiency and overall thermal performance of the system.
